Cost of Asphalt Driveway Installation in Rocklin
Considering installing an asphalt driveway in Rocklin, CA? Understanding the costs involved can help you budget effectively and ensure you get the best value for your investment. Asphalt driveways are a popular choice due to their durability and relatively low maintenance requirements. Here’s a breakdown of the factors influencing costs and common tasks associated with asphalt driveway installation in Rocklin, CA.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ing overall costs.
- Material Quality: Higher-grade asphalt can be more expensive but offers greater durability and longevity.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ary based on the complexity of the installation and the experience of the contractor.
- Site Preparation: Costs may increase if significant grading or removal of existing materials is required.
- Drainage Requirements: Proper drainage solutions can add to the overall cost but are essential for long-term performance.
- Permits and Regulations: Local permits and compliance with Rocklin, CA regulations can affect the total cost.
- Accessibility: Easier access to the site can reduce labor costs, while difficult-to-reach areas may increase them.
